Description:
MRI-guided Radiation Therapy (MRgRT), FLASH proton therapy, concurrent immunotherapy, and radiation therapy and SBRT for oligometastatic disease, are emerging technologies and approaches to optimize cancer care. The number of academic and community centers acquiring these technologies has rapidly increased recently both nationally and internationally. There is not usually a technology-specific structured training. Many centers are now acquiring or having access to these approaches. This activity provides evidence-based, practical, non-commercially biased insight on current status, scientific evidence, and practical limitations of these approaches. This activity will interest radiation staff in centers recently acquired, those considering acquiring, and those interested to learn more about any of these technologies. Speakers are experienced in these specific technologies, with expertise in different tumor sites both in academic and community practice settings. The activity covers benefits and challenges utilizing each technology and addresses feasibility and challenges to implement these approaches in a resources-constrained environment including international low- and middle-income countries and U.S.-based rural/community practices. The presentations are followed by an engaging panel discussion to address the cost effectiveness of these technologies in different situations. Learning Objectives:
Upon completion of this activity, participants should be able to:

  • Identify the value, current evidence, and limitations of innovative radiation therapy approaches.  
  • Identify available global training opportunities.
  • Discuss the cost-benefit of implementing these technologies in both academic and community settings, with special emphasis on resources constrained environments nationally and internationally. 
  • Determine optimal patients' cohorts to be considered for these approaches and safe treatment delivery practices.
